Description: | Too hot in Tampa to work outside, and the big stuff is already done, so I thought I would do some fun stuff inside. A few months ago I installed a 50 Gallon gray tank I picked up at a sale. It is plumbed between the kitchen sink and the original gray tank. I put a Valterra valve on the tank so I can keep the two tanks separate. When ready to dump, I drain the main tank, then the aux. tank. I also have it configured to I can pump the original tank back up in to the large tank for added showering boondocking capacity. Today I got around to building the platform bed around it. | ||
